If you're in doubt how Intellectual Property makes money for you, feel free to read this advise offered by a much respected icon of the Nigerian/Canadian/Global Intellectual community, Pius Adesanmi

"Jesse: At least three private bloggers in the USA approached me for my last op-ed in Sahara Reporters on Emma Watson's feminism. I gave consent and moved on. Surprise surprise, I received PDF consent forms by email asking me to sign and give them permission to use the piece. I nearly ignored them with the usual Nigerian which kain wahala be this but I filled the form and sent to them. I woke up this morning to more emails about where I want to be paid! One wants to pay 100 dollars, the last two are offering 200 dollars each - just to use a piece I already published and which is freely in circulation all over Facebook and Twitter. Then came two South African publications this afternoon asking for my permission to use the piece. The total haul from them will come to about 500 dollars. I may rake in a thousand dollars for one piece by bloggers insisting on integrity and respecting my intellectual property rights. I for no even mind if dem all use the piece just like that o so long as they don't change the name of the author. The wider he circulation of the piece the better for the writer. But totally unknown bloggers have gone to this length to do things properly. In France, one blogger asked for my permission to translate a Facebook update I wrote about race in Missouri during the Ferguson wahala. He wants to use it for his blog in France. He offered 80 Euros - to translate and use a Facebook update. Still in France, somebody proposed 200 Euros to me for something else. I could go on and on but I am sure you get my drift here in support of your post."
